
#51 - Supplements: Are There Any Worth Taking?
About this episode
Supplements are a huge industry, and showing no signs of slowing down. The idea that a pill, or a powder, or a drink can transform your fitness and body composition is irresistible, it seems, as people continue to pour billions of dollars into the supplement industry. Do any of them actually work though? And if so, which ones?
Dr. Robert Santana and Coach Trent Jones wade through the most popular performance enhancing supplements, and offer an opinion which runs counter to what most will tell you: most of them DON'T work, and if you aren't training hard and cultivating healthy daily habits, NONE of the will work! For those of you willing to do the hard work, however, there are a couple supplements which might help you gain a little edge in the gym. But you probably didn't need it anyway.
